Главная страница
Top.Mail.Ru    Яндекс.Метрика
Текущий архив: 2006.03.26;
Скачать: CL | DM;

Вниз

FireBird   Найти похожие ветки 

 
vital538 ©   (2006-03-06 21:08) [0]

Подскажите, пожалуйста, а как в процедуре можно установить значение генератора в ноль?


 
Desdechado ©   (2006-03-06 21:30) [1]

делать так - это не очень хорошо,
но если очень надо, то можно так
nUserID = gen_id( genUSERID, -( nUserID - 1 ) );   /* сброс генератора */


 
Desdechado ©   (2006-03-06 21:32) [2]

сорри, вот так
nUserID = gen_id( genUSERID, - gen_id( genUSERID, 0 ) );   /* сброс генератора */


 
_dimka ©   (2006-03-07 10:30) [3]

зачем так? можно же SET GENERATOR name TO 0


 
Сергей М. ©   (2006-03-07 10:57) [4]


> _dimka ©   (07.03.06 10:30) [3]


> SET GENERATOR name TO 0


В FB PSQL нет никаких SET.


 
Sergey13 ©   (2006-03-07 11:24) [5]

Здается мне автор хочет генератор юзать для чего то нестандартного.


 
_dimka ©   (2006-03-07 14:51) [6]


> В FB PSQL нет никаких SET.

Почему нет???
http://www.ibase.ru/devinfo/generator.htm
Это обычный ddl оператор. Он не может быть выполнен в процедуре или триггере (за исключением определенных версий Yaffil).


 
Сергей М. ©   (2006-03-07 16:47) [7]


> _dimka ©   (07.03.06 14:51) [6]


> Почему нет?


Да по кочану.


> Это обычный ddl оператор


Заметь - ddl !

А вовсе не psql, о котором явно ведет речь автор.


> Он не может быть выполнен в процедуре или триггере


Ы ?



Страницы: 1 вся ветка

Текущий архив: 2006.03.26;
Скачать: CL | DM;

Наверх




Память: 0.48 MB
Время: 0.084 c
4-1136582918
g-l-u-k
2006-01-07 00:28
2006.03.26
Получение PID


2-1142000790
KyRo
2006-03-10 17:26
2006.03.26
TADOConnection


1-1140515584
-=ARMAN=-
2006-02-21 12:53
2006.03.26
Как запустить программу из памяти?


11-1122956597
Кудрявцев Павел
2005-08-02 08:23
2006.03.26
Базы данных и KOL


2-1141668485
Vitaly73
2006-03-06 21:08
2006.03.26
mp3-проигрыватель